ICICI BANK ATM
L & T Techno Park, Waghodia, Baroda, Vaghodia, Gujarat, 391760, Vaghodia - , , India
At & Post Nepanagar, Madhya Pradesh 450221, Vaghodia - , , India
Cat.Iii Block No.24/139 Po.Kevadia Colony, Vaghodia - , , India
Palayampatti Br., 5-18-1-A, Madurai Road, Opp. Thirukumarannagar Bus Stop, Palayampatti, Vaghodia - , , India
Behind Vikas High School Shahade Shahade 425409 Maharashtra India, Vaghodia - , , India
Old No.11.1.279, New No.252, Madurai Road, Aruppukottai Arupukottai 626101 Tamil Nadu India, Vaghodia - , , India